Historic Columbia River Highway

Historic Columbia River Highway

Historic Columbia River Highway, Corbett, OR

Drive the historic highway. The best way to explain to get on is to put in your gps. Vista House at Crown Point". Then you will just follow Hwy 84. To ensure you stay on it all the way to Cascade Locks which I recommend if you want to pass all the waterfalls, you can add stops to "Latourrell Falls" and "Wahkeena Falls". These are all great stops as well! Wahkeena Falls is much easier to park at than Multnomah Falls and is only 1/2mi hike from one to other so I recommend parking and walking. You will see the trail to your left once you go up by the falls. It's well labeled :)

Multnomah Falls viewpoint and/or hike

Multnomah Falls viewpoint and/or hike

OR 97014

Parking can be difficult. Very touristy. Can make into a loop hike. See Alltrails or message me personally with any hiking questions if wanting to make a hike. I would love to help. Pro pro pro TIP (very important if wanting to go): Park At Wahkeena, do not go all way to Multnomah on highway unlesss need handicapped access. Rules are constantly changing but parking is always INSANE and starting to be charged (it's like an amusement park over there). From Wahkeena, you can walk off side of highway 1/4mi and be there a LOT faster than trying to park in big lot. It's very worth it! Recommend going early

Biking

Biking

There are endless paved biking trails which you will likely see the whole drive from Portland to Hood River along the gorge. I like starting at Starvation Creek trailhead where you'll see some waterfalls or we recently did the Hood River to Mosier portion which is called twin tunnels as you will bike through old tunnels overlooking the gorge. It's really pretty. Both are fun! When you rent your bike, they can give you more info.
